What is the National Bike Challenge?
The National Bike Challenge is a nationwide event uniting thousands of current bicyclists and encouraging countless new riders. It is a free and easy way to challenge yourself, your colleagues and your community to ride more while competing on a local, state and national level. The challenge starts May 1st and finishes on September 30th.

Why join a team?
Using Strava to log your rides produces a “heat map” on their site showing the most traveled routes. We can zoom in to our City and see which routes cyclists are currently using and where the needs are for more infrastructure.

There are prizes for teams that log the most miles – you score 20 points each day your ride and 1 point for each mile ridden. All outdoor rides count.
